How to Polish Brick
- 1). Fit the polisher with the heaviest grit pad. The pad snaps into place using plastic fittings on most polishers and cannot be installed backward.
- 2). Spray the brick surface thoroughly with water. When complete, turn off the hose and set it out of the way.
- 3). Hold the polisher tightly by the handles, then pull the trigger. The polisher will want to turn counterclockwise, so you must hold onto the handle. This also allows you to guide where the polisher goes.
- 4). Sweep the polisher back and forth across the surface of the brick, allowing the weight of the polisher to do the work.
- 5). Release the trigger of the polisher, then switch the polishing pad to the next heaviest grit. Wet down the brick again with the garden hose, before continuing. Continue to work in this fashion, until the brick has been polished with the 1000 grit polish -- at this point you will be done.
